While most of us suffer from mild headaches periodically, some people suffer from severe headaches and find their lives significantly disrupted by the pain and other problems that they cause.
Headaches can be very tricky for doctors to diagnose and sometimes equally difficult to treat. They may have different causes and many different symptoms. It is also common for patients to actually suffer from more than one type of headache. This combination of headaches is challenging to treat.
